仓酷云
标题:
来看看:Linux基本:文件体系范例常识先容
[打印本页]
作者:
若相依
时间:
2015-1-16 11:34
标题:
来看看:Linux基本:文件体系范例常识先容
系统管理相关命令:df、top、free、quota、at、lp、adduser、groupaddkill、crontab、tar、unzip、gunzip、last
跟着Linux的不休开展,Linux所撑持的文件体系范例也在敏捷扩大。陪伴着Linux2.4版本的刊行,呈现了大批的文件体系大概性,个中包含ReiserFS、XFS、JFS和别的文件体系。每个分歧版本的Linux所撑持的文件体系范例品种都有所分歧,怎样晓得本人的Linux刊行版本的范例哪?能够如许操纵:(以笔者使用的MandrakeLinux8.2为例,)
以超等用户权限上岸Linux,进进/Lib/modules/2.4.18-6mdk/kernel/fs目次实行命令(分歧Linux刊行版本的Fs目次有些分歧你能够用查找FS文件夹的办法找到它):
#ls
MandrakeLinux撑持的文件体系范例
/Lib/modules/2.4.18-6mdk/kernel/fs中查出以后体系所撑持的文件体系品种。从图-1中能够看到笔者利用的MandrakeLinux8.2撑持的文件体系十分多。Linux体系中心撑持十多种文件体系范例:jfs、ReiserFS、ext、ext2、ext3、iso9660、xfs、minx、msdos、umsdos、Vfat、NTFS、Hpfs、Nfs、smb、sysv、proc等。
这里我们对最经常使用的几个文件体系的开展情形和优弱点作具体先容:ext、ext2、ext3、jsf、、xfs、ReiserFS。
1、ext
ext是第一个专门为Linux的文件体系范例,叫做扩大文件体系。它在1992年4月完成的。它为Linux的开展获得了主要感化。可是在功能和兼容性上存在很多缺点。如今已很少利用了。
2、ext2
ext2是为办理ext文件体系的缺点而计划的可扩大的高功能的文件体系。又被称为二级扩大文件体系。它是在1993年公布的,计划者是ReyCard。ext2是Linux文件体系范例中利用最多的格局。而且在速率和CPU使用率上较凸起,是GNU/Linux体系中尺度的文件体系,其特性为存取文件的功能极好,关于中小型的文件更显现出上风,这次要得利于其簇快取层的优秀计划。Ext2能够撑持256字节的长文件名,其单一文件巨细与文件体系自己的容量下限与文件体系自己的簇巨细有关,在一样平常罕见的Intelx86兼容处置器的体系中,簇最年夜为4KB,则单一文件巨细下限为2048GB,而文件体系的容量下限为6384GB。只管Linux能够撑持品种单一的文件体系,可是2000年之前几近一切的Linux刊行版都用ext2作为默许的文件体系。
ext2的弱点:ext2的计划者次要思索的是文件体系功能方面的成绩。ext2在写进文件内容的同时并没有同时写进文件的meta-data(和文件有关的信息,比方:权限、一切者和创立和会见工夫)。换句话说,Linux先写进文件的内容,然后比及有空的时分才写进文件的meta-data。如许若呈现写进文件内容以后但在写进文件的meta-data之前体系俄然断电,便可能形成在文件体系就会处于纷歧致的形态。在一个有大批文件操纵的体系中呈现这类情形会招致很严峻的成果。别的但因为今朝中心2.4所能利用的单一支解区最年夜只要2048GB,只管文件体系的容量下限为6384G可是实践上能利用的文件体系容量最多也只要2048GB。
3、ext3
ext3是由开放资本社区开辟的日记文件体系,次要开辟职员是Stephentweedie。ext3被计划成是ext2的晋级版本,尽量中央便用户从ext2fs向ext3fs迁徙。ext3在ext2的基本上到场了纪录元数据的日记功效,勉力坚持向前和向后的兼容性。这个文件体系被称为ext2的下一个版本。也就是在保有今朝ext2的格局之下再加上日记功效。ext3是一种日记式文件体系。日记式文件体系的优胜性在于:因为文件体系都有快取层介入运作,如不利用时必需将文件体系卸下,以便将快取层的材料写回磁盘中。因而每当体系要关机时,必需将其一切的文件体系全体卸下后才干举行关机。假如在文件体系还没有卸下前就关机(如停电)时,下次重开机后会形成文件体系的材料纷歧致,故这时候必需做文件体系的重整事情,将纷歧致与毛病的中央修复。但是,此一重整的事情是相称耗时的,出格是容量年夜的文件体系,并且也不克不及百分之百包管一切的材料都不会流掉。故这在年夜型的伺服器上大概会形成成绩。
ext3的弱点:其最年夜的弱点是没有古代文件体系所具有的能进步文件数据处置速率息争压的高功能,别的利用ext3文件体系时要注重硬盘限额成绩,在这个成绩办理之前,不保举在主要的企业使用上接纳ext3+diskquota(磁盘配额)。
4、jsf
jsf供应了基于日记的字节级文件体系,该文件体系是为面向事件的高功能体系而开辟的。jsf(JournaledFileSystemTechnologyforLinux)的开辟者包含AIX(IBM的Unix)的jsf的次要开辟者。在AIX上,jfs已承受住了磨练。它是牢靠、疾速和简单利用的。2000年2月,ibm公布在一个开放资本允许证下,移植linux版的JSF文件体系。JSFs也是一个有大批用户安装利用的企业级文件体系。它具有可伸缩性和强健性,与非日记文件体系比拟,它的长处是其疾速重启才能:Jfs可以在几秒或几分钟内就把文件体系恢复到分歧形态。固然jsf次要是为满意服务器(从单处置器体系到初级多处置器和聚集体系)的高吞吐量和牢靠性需求而计划的,jsf还可用于想失掉高功能和牢靠性的客户机设置由于在体系溃散时,jsf能供应疾速文件体系重启工夫,以是它是因特网文件服务器的关头手艺。利用数据库日记处置手艺,jsf能在几秒或几分钟以内把文件体系恢复到分歧形态。而在非日记文件体系中,文件恢复大概消费几小时或几天。
jsf的弱点:利用jsf日记文件体系,功能上会有必定丧失,体系资本占用的比率也偏高。是由于当它坚持一个日记时,体系必要写很多数据。
5、ReiserFS
ReiserFS的第一次公然表态是在1997年7月23日,HansReiser把他的基于均衡树布局的ReiserFS文件体系在网上发布。ReiserFS3.6.x(作为Linux2.4一部分的版本)是由HansReiser和他的在Namesys的开辟组配合开辟计划的。Hans和他的组员们信任最好的文件体系是那些可以有助于创立自力的共享情况大概定名空间的文件体系,使用程序能够在个中更间接、无效和无力地互相感化。为了完成这一方针,文件体系就应当满意其利用者对功能和功效方面的必要。那样,利用者就可以够持续间接地利用文件体系,而不用制作运转在文件体系之上(如数据库之类)的特别目标层。Reise
12下一页
当你经过一段时间的学习后就应该扩充自己的知识,多学习linux命令,但是不要在初学阶段就系统的学习linux命令。
作者:
金色的骷髅
时间:
2015-1-17 17:30
众所周知,目前windows操作系统是主流,在以后相当长的时间内不会有太大的改变,其方便友好的图形界面吸引了众多的用户。
作者:
因胸联盟
时间:
2015-1-21 07:38
如果你有庞大而复杂的测试条件,尽量把它剪裁得越小越好。可能你会遇到这种情况,对于一个问题会出现不同内容回答,这时你需要通过实践来验证。
作者:
山那边是海
时间:
2015-1-30 11:12
众所周知,目前windows操作系统是主流,在以后相当长的时间内不会有太大的改变,其方便友好的图形界面吸引了众多的用户。
作者:
兰色精灵
时间:
2015-2-6 10:52
让我树立了很大的信心学好这门课程,也学到了不少专业知识和技能。?
作者:
简单生活
时间:
2015-2-16 00:25
用户下达的命令解释给系统去执行,并将系统传回的信息再次解释给用户,估shell也称为命令解释器,有关命令的学习可参考论坛相关文章,精通英文也是学习Linux的关键。
作者:
谁可相欹
时间:
2015-3-4 19:23
如果你想深入学习Linux,看不懂因为文档实在是太难了。写的最好的、最全面的文档都是英语写的,最先发布的技术信息也都是用英语写的。
作者:
仓酷云
时间:
2015-3-11 20:49
通过一条缓慢的调制解调器线路,它也能操纵几千公里以外的远程系统。
作者:
变相怪杰
时间:
2015-3-19 13:51
熟读写基础知识,学得会不如学得牢。
作者:
活着的死人
时间:
2015-3-28 14:29
通过一条缓慢的调制解调器线路,它也能操纵几千公里以外的远程系统。
欢迎光临 仓酷云 (http://ckuyun.com/)
Powered by Discuz! X3.2